Wednesday, October 25: Cultural Experiences in Dubai
Start your day by visiting the Dubai Museum in Al Fahidi Fort, where you can learn about the history and heritage of Dubai. In the afternoon, explore the traditional markets of Deira, including the vibrant Gold Souk and Spice Souk. End the day with a relaxing abra (water taxi) ride along Dubai Creek, taking in the sights and sounds of the city.
Deira Markets: Free entry, estimated time: 2-3 hours
Dubai Creek Abra Ride: AED 1, estimated time: 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ites
For a unique family-friendly experience, visit the Dubai Miracle Garden. It's a breathtaking display of millions of flowers arranged in stunning patterns and structures. Another hidden gem is The Green Planet, an indoor tropical rainforest in Dubai, where you can explore diverse ecosystems and interact with exotic animals. Both attractions offer an educational and entertaining experience for the whole family.
